Explore BasketInvestment Analysis

Lovesac
LOVE
Pros
- Lovesac maintains a strong gross margin above sector average, reflecting pricing power and efficient cost management.
- The company's modular furniture products continue to drive consistent consumer demand, supporting stable sales growth.
- Lovesac trades at a lower price-to-sales ratio than sector peers, suggesting potential undervaluation.
Considerations
- Recent gross margin contraction indicates rising input or operational costs, pressuring profitability.
- Stock price volatility and sharp pre-market declines signal investor concerns over near-term earnings performance.
- Revenue guidance remains unchanged despite margin pressure, limiting upside from operational improvements.

Entravision
EVC
Pros
- Entravision's advertising technology segment achieved over 100% year-on-year revenue growth, driven by AI investments and expanded sales capacity.
- The company has reduced its debt by $15 million in 2025, strengthening its balance sheet and financial flexibility.
- Consolidated revenue grew 24% in Q3 2025, reflecting robust expansion in digital and programmatic advertising services.
Considerations
- Media segment revenue declined 26% year-on-year, mainly due to lower political and national advertising demand.
- Operating losses persist due to restructuring charges and impairment costs, raising concerns about profitability.
- Stock performance remains weak despite revenue growth, indicating market skepticism about turnaround prospects.
